Company Overview - Lens Technology Co., Ltd. is located in Liuyang, Hunan Province, China, and was established on December 21, 2006. It was listed on March 18, 2015. The company primarily engages in the research, production, and sales of protective panels for electronic products, with its main product being mobile phone protective screens [2] - The company's revenue composition includes 82.48% from smartphones and computers, 9.60% from smart automotive and cockpit, 5.00% from smart headsets and wearables, 1.82% from other business income, and 1.10% from other smart terminal products [2] Financial Performance - For the first half of 2025, Lens Technology achieved operating revenue of 32.96 billion yuan, representing a year-on-year growth of 14.18%. The net profit attributable to the parent company was 1.143 billion yuan, with a year-on-year increase of 32.68% [2] - The company has distributed a total of 9.465 billion yuan in dividends since its A-share listing, with 4.452 billion yuan distributed in the last three years [3] Stock Market Activity - On September 12, the stock price of Lens Technology fell by 2.03%, trading at 29.50 yuan per share, with a total transaction volume of 1.675 billion yuan and a turnover rate of 1.13%.
